Dollar Tree Inc

CONSUMER DEFENSIVE · DISCOUNT STORES · USA

Dollar Tree is an American chain of discount variety stores that sells items for $1 or less, headquartered in Chesapeake, Virginia.

John B Sanfilippo & Son Inc

CONSUMER DEFENSIVE · PACKAGED FOODS · USA

John B. Sanfilippo & Son, Inc., along with its subsidiary, JBSS Ventures, LLC, processes and distributes tree nuts and peanuts in the United States. The company is headquartered in Elgin, Illinois.
